At his death in 2015 he held the record for the youngest ever recipient of the award. According to the Telegraph, Davis aged 16 was already used to climbing bomb damaged and dangerous buildings in post World World War II London. He was walking near Borough High Street in Southwark when he saw a group of people screaming at a toddler leaning out of an open 6th floor window 80 feet above street level
When this proved impossible he made climbed onto the roof of the building before making a perilous 10 foot drop onto the back balcony.
His story made headlines and the Bishop of Southwark presented his medal on 30 May 1949. He was also awarded the Carnegie Hero Fund Trust bronze medal though he was always extremely reticent about discussing his deceased
